(1) Can the Minister list the current staffing allocation for each government school in the Pilbara?
(2) How many first teacher graduates were teaching in each Pilbara government school at the commencement of 2009?
(3) Can the Minister please table the full details of the current salaries and allowances that the Government has agreed to pay teachers and staff working in Western Australian Government schools across Western Australia, with particular reference to the teachers and staff working in regional and remote schools?
(4) Can the Minister please advise what annual airfare entitlements are available for teachers and staff at the Western Australian Government remote community schools?

School Name BALER PS 2 HEDLAND SHS 4 KARRATHA PS 1 KARRATHA SHS 3 MILLARSWELL PS 2 NEWMAN PS 4 NEWMAN SHS 7 PARABURDOO PS 4 PORT HEDLAND PS 3 PORT HEDLANDS SOTA 1 ROEBOURNE DHS 3 SOUTH HEDLAND PS 1 SOUTH NEWMAN PS 4 TOM PRICE SHS 1 WICKHAM PS 3 TOTAL 43 (3) Details of salary rates and allowances payable to teachers and Administrators under the School Education Act Employees' (Teachers and Administrators) General Agreement 2008 are attached. This includes allowances paid to teachers and Administrators located in regional and remote schools. Salary rates and allowances payable to school support staff are in accordance with the relevant Award and Industrial Agreement under which an officer is employed. A list of Awards and Industrial Agreements pertaining to school support staff is attached (Appendix 2). [see tabled paper no.] (4) Teachers employed in Western Australian Government remote community schools receive three (3) travel concessions per annum, one (1) for travel to the nearest main centre and two (2) to Perth and return. One (1) travel concession per annum to Perth and return is provided to some non-teaching staff, subject to the employee type and the schools location.
